JOB SUMMARY:


Lantic is currently recruiting for the 2-year contract position of Health and Safety Coordinator for the operations department based at our Montreal refinery. Reporting to the Health, Safety & Site Security Manager, the incumbent ensures adherence to the overall safety culture within the refinery and offices in Montreal by verifying, maintaining, and improving the health and safety program in collaboration with their team.

RESPONSIBILITIES:


  • Identify and analyze workplace-related risks and participate in implementing appropriate action plans and corrective measures;
  • Provide support to the refinery management team in preventing and resolving health and safety issues, as well as implementing the occupational health and safety (OHS) strategy;
  • Advise and influence the management team on best practices regarding OHS;
  • Coordinate OHS activities, audits, emergency measures, OHS committees, safety training, etc.;
  • Develop and disseminate safety training modules and programs that meet legal requirements, company policies, procedures, and practices;
  • Collaborate with human resources in the return-to-work process and new employee integration programs;
  • Design, review, and update health and safety programs for the Montreal plant;
  • Participate in various OHS committees;
  • Conduct training and informational sessions;
  • Contribute to maintaining and improving various management systems in place such as lockout/tagout, confined space, WHMIS (Workplace Hazardous Materials Information System), investigations, accidents, etc.
